Ukrainian Officials Arrest Former Military Commissioner for Corruption and Treason

TL;DR Summary
The State Bureau of Investigation in Ukraine has detained Yevhen Borysov, the former head of the Odesa Regional Center for Recruitment and Social Support, who is suspected of illegal enrichment and evasion of duty. Borysov attempted to evade the investigation by changing his phone numbers, cars, and location, but was eventually found and detained in Kyiv. The investigation has uncovered evidence of his illegal enrichment, including the ownership of expensive foreign real estate and luxury vehicles by his family members. The SBI will seek detention without bail for Borysov, and he could face up to ten years in prison if convicted.
